By the editors · 2 min readA warm-spicy composition built on three materials: ginger, cinnamon, and bergamot at the top, with vanilla anchoring the base. The opening is vivid and direct — ginger's sharp, slightly medicinal spice alongside cinnamon's sweet warmth, brightened and lifted by bergamot's citrus clarity.
Vanilla in the base takes the composition firmly into sweet-spicy territory as the citrus fades. The transition is simple but satisfying: brightness gives way to warmth, spice softens and sweetens. There is little complexity in the structure, but the materials work well together.
Suited to cold-weather wear, this fragrance functions as a cozy, unpretentious spice-vanilla — straightforward and comforting rather than ambitious or challenging.
